Rocky Point - Sunday

Malaga Cove on Sunday

Didnt get any WSB or Halis

We did find some Nice calicos, a few smaller rockfish, a ling cod and a bunch of sharks. (fun rides)

All fish are back in the water.

Water was about 70.
Spanish, Greenies, smelt and horse sardines all made easy in the am, not too easy later in the day.

Did not see or catch any squid.
